Output 51fcfcd5ac5753db3430a05267dd80612327502d4861dcc2e9763d8567563504:0

value
99092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d33aefae7dc13c85331ae538576c9544044e79cd OP_EQUAL
address
3Lwu6yxZ4syN5gijqR49WcvFUX7GJdSQtj
transaction
51fcfcd5ac5753db3430a05267dd80612327502d4861dcc2e9763d8567563504
spent
true